'While taking orders, I was stopped from using the lift of the mall', Zomato CEO shared his experience
Zomato: To know the challenges faced by delivery partners, Zomato CEO Deepinder Goyal played the role of a delivery boy. Sharing the incident that happened with him during this, he alleged that he was stopped from using the lift in a mall in Gurugram.

On Sunday, Zomato CEO Deepinder Goyal claimed that a mall in Gurugram barred him from using the lift while taking food orders as a delivery executive. Deepinder Goyal, who played the role of a delivery partner with his wife Grecia Munoz, said that when he went to Ambience Mall to take the order, he was asked to go by stairs. Actually, he became a delivery partner to face the challenges faced by delivery partners.
He shared a post on X, tagging a video explaining the experience in the uniform of the Zomato delivery agent. He elaborated, "During the second order, I realised the need to collaborate more with the mall to get better working conditions for all delivery partners and the need for the mall to be more humane towards the delivery partners.". The CEO of Zomato said he was not allowed to use the lift of the mall while taking the order.
He said we reached the Ambience Mall in Gurugram to take an order from Haldiram. I was asked to go from another entrance. Then, I began to realize they were asking me to go by stairs. I went inside again from the main entrance to crosscheck that there was no lift for the delivery partner. Deepinder Goyal mentioned that he used the stairs and went to the third floor, as he found that the delivery partners can't enter the mall and they have to wait on the stairs for receiving the order.
During this, he had fun with his fellow delivery partners and also received valuable feedback from them. The boss of Zomato said that he finally managed to sneak in to collect the order when the staircase guard took a break. Reacting to his post, several users said that it's not the malls alone but many societies too that do not allow entry to their main elevators to the delivery partners. One user felt that every society, mall, and office should make it compulsory to take delivery partners using normal regular common elevators and entrances/exits without any partitioning.
